    It is an observatory with a panoramic view of the Pacific coastline of Hokkaido. This was used as a road that passes through the coastline of Kushiro ⇔ Tokachi in the past (currently, the new road has been completed and it is easier to drive), but the view is overwhelming on this road. If you have time, please take a look. You can also see the closed tunnel now.
